In the rapidly evolving digital landscape, remote work has transitioned from being a trend to becoming a standard in software development. As a product manager, collaborating with a remote development team presents distinct challenges and opportunities. Whether dealing with different time zones, ensuring effective communication, or managing team dynamics, product managers need to adapt to maximize the potential of remote collaborations.
Understanding the Remote Development Landscape
The first step in effectively working with a remote development team is understanding the unique characteristics of such setups. Remote teams can be spread across various geographical locations, each with its own time zone, culture, and work habits. These factors can lead to communication barriers, misunderstandings, and scheduling conflicts. Furthermore, the lack of face-to-face interaction may sometimes hinder the building of trust and the development of strong team cohesion.
The Rise of Remote Teams in Product Development
Remote work wasn’t always the norm. Historically, development teams were predominantly on-site, allowing for direct in-person collaboration. However, advancements in technology, the globalization of talent, and, more recently, the global pandemic have accelerated the shift toward remote work. As a result, many organizations have embraced the remote model, leveraging a global talent pool and offering flexibility that was previously unimaginable.
Companies choose remote work for its numerous advantages, such as cost savings, access to a broader talent pool, and increased employee satisfaction. This shift requires a corresponding change in management strategy, especially for product managers who need to enhance their skill set to overcome the challenges associated with remote collaboration.
Communication: The Foundation of Remote Collaboration
One of the most significant challenges of working with a remote team is maintaining clear and efficient communication. Miscommunication can lead to errors, delays, and wasted resources. Here’s how product managers can refine their communication approaches:
Leverage the Right Tools: Choose communication tools that suit the team’s needs. Whether it’s Slack, Microsoft Teams, or Zoom, ensure that tools facilitate both asynchronous and synchronous communication efficiently.
Establish Clear Communication Protocols: Define how and when team members are expected to communicate. This could involve regular updates, check-ins, and the use of project management software to keep everyone aligned.
Encourage Over-Communication: Encourage team members to share more information than they think is necessary. It’s better to have too much context than too little, preventing misunderstandings.
Regular Meetings and Updates: Regular touchpoints are crucial in remote setups. This can be through daily stand-ups, weekly demos, or bi-weekly sprint reviews to ensure everyone is on the same page.
Time Zone Awareness: With team members spread across the globe, it’s important to be mindful of time zone differences and schedule meetings at times that are reasonable for all participants.
Building Trust and a Team Culture Remotely
Trust is the cornerstone of any successful team, but building it remotely requires deliberate actions:
Foster Open Communication: Create an environment where team members feel comfortable sharing their thoughts and concerns. This can be achieved through regular one-on-ones and by creating a culture of openness.
Celebrate Wins and Learn from Failures: Acknowledge individual and team achievements publicly and use mistakes as learning opportunities rather than grounds for blame.
Invest in Team Building: Virtual team-building activities can help in strengthening relationships. Consider hosting virtual coffee breaks, games, or even annual retreats if possible.
Cultural Sensitivity and Inclusivity: Be mindful of cultural differences and work towards creating an inclusive team environment. Encourage team members to share their cultures and backgrounds.
Setting Clear Goals and Expectations
Without the structure of an office environment, remote teams can sometimes struggle with focus and productivity. Set your team up for success by establishing clear goals and expectations:
Define Clear Objectives: Provide clear, concise, and measurable goals. Use frameworks like OKRs (Objectives and Key Results) to align the team’s efforts with the company’s strategic vision.
Create a Roadmap: A product roadmap offers a high-level visual summary of the vision and direction of your product offering. It’s an invaluable tool for communicating what you’re building and why.
Regular Progress Reviews: Conducting regular reviews helps keep the team on track, ensuring any issues are addressed promptly.
Leveraging Technology for Remote Team Management
Numerous tools can assist product managers in overseeing remote development teams efficiently:
Project Management Tools: Tools such as Jira, Trello, or Asana can help keep track of tasks, timelines, and deliverables, ensuring transparency and accountability.
Documentation Platforms: Services like Confluence or Notion enable effective documentation management, which is vital for knowledge sharing and onboarding new team members.
Version Control Systems: Tools such as GitHub or GitLab facilitate collaboration on code, making it easy to track changes and contributions.
Handling Time Zones and Work Schedules
Time zones can serve as both a challenge and an opportunity. Here’s how to effectively manage them:
Flexible Work Hours: Encourage flexible schedules to accommodate time zone differences, allowing team members to work when they are most productive.
Overlap Hours: Identify windows of time where most of the team can meet (often a couple of hours each day) and schedule important meetings during these periods.
Document Everything: Encourage detailed recording of meetings and decisions so those in different time zones can catch up asynchronously.
The Importance of Feedback Loops
In a remote setting, feedback is essential for continuous improvement and alignment. Establishing effective feedback loops allows for adaptation and course correction:
Regular Feedback: Make feedback a regular part of the process rather than a periodic event. Tools like 360-degree feedback can provide comprehensive insights.
Sprint Retrospectives: After each sprint, conduct retrospectives to discuss what worked well and what could be improved. This fosters a culture of continuous improvement.
Open Door Policies: Maintain an open door for feedback outside of formal meetings to encourage honesty and transparency.
Overcoming Common Challenges
Working with remote teams doesn’t come without its hurdles. Here are some common challenges and how to address them:
Isolation: Remote work can often lead to feelings of isolation. Regular interaction, informal chats, and ensuring that team members feel part of a community can alleviate loneliness.
Visibility: It can be challenging for remote workers to gain visibility. Encourage sharing of successes and maintain regular communications to combat this issue.
Engagement: Keeping remote team members motivated requires effort. Regular recognition, career development opportunities, and engagement surveys can help maintain morale.
The Future of Product Management with Remote Teams
As businesses continue to embrace remote work, product managers will play an integral role in shaping the future of collaboration. This includes adapting to new tools, fostering a culture of inclusion and continuous feedback, and maintaining high standards of communication and productivity. With the right strategies in place, remote development teams can achieve remarkable results, pushing the boundaries of innovation and delivering exceptional products.
Navigating remote work dynamics is no small feat, but by leveraging these strategies, product managers can ensure their remote development teams are not just surviving, but thriving in the digital workplace. By focusing on communication, culture, tools, and adaptability, product managers can turn the challenges of remote work into opportunities for growth and success.
In the ever-evolving landscape of digital marketing, understanding user interactions with your website is paramount. Read more
In the current digital age, web applications have become an integral part of our daily lives, from social networking to online shopping and everything in between. Read more
In the fast-paced world of digital applications, user experience (UX) has become pivotal in determining the success or failure of a web application. Read more
In today's digital-driven world, having an online presence is paramount for the success of any business. Read more
In the sprawling universe of website data, it can be hard to know what's really happening with your site. Read more
In today's data-driven world, having accurate and actionable insights from your website is crucial. Read more
In today's digital world, web applications must be finely tuned to meet the varying needs of their users. Read more
In the digital age where data drives decision-making, Google Analytics serves as an indispensable tool for marketers, developers, and business owners. Read more
In the world of web applications, success often brings with it a unique set of challenges. Read more
In today's fast-paced tech landscape, software development teams are constantly facing the challenge of deciding which features to tackle next. Read more